STEPS Trial - Spheramine Safety and Efficacy Study

Study of the Safety, Tolerability and Efficacy of Spheramine Implanted Bilaterally Into the Postcommissural Putamen of Patients With Advanced Parkinson's Disease

Brief summary

The purpose of the study is to explore the safety, tolerability and efficacy of Spheramine (cultured human retinal pigment epithelial cells on microcarriers) in Parkinson's Disease patients with advanced disease who have insufficient symptom control by optimum oral medication. Patients are randomized to receive Spheramine injections into both hemispheres or a sham surgical procedure in a ratio of 1:1. A three month pretreatment period must be completed prior to surgery. Time to endpoint is 24 months.

Interventions

Bilateral implantation of Spheramine into the postcommissural putamen, each side at a dose of 325,000 cells

PROCEDUREPlacebo

Sham surgery procedure without penetration of the dura mater. Nothing wil be implanted into the brain.

Inclusion criteria

* Advanced Parkinson's disease for at least 5 years * Good response to L-dopa * Age 30 to 70 years * Optimum oral therapy

Exclusion criteria

* Tremor only * Dementia * Very severe dyskinesia * Previous brain surgery including deep brain stimulation * Malignant disease

Design outcomes

Primary

MeasureTime frame
Change in UPDRS part III (Motor Score) in the defined medication at 12 months post surgery12 months post surgery

Secondary

MeasureTime frame
Change in UPDRS Part III in ON at 12 months post surgery12 months post surgery
Amount of L-dopa reduction at 12 months post surgery12 months post surgery
Change in total UPDRS in ON and OFF at 12 months post surgery12 months post surgery
Quality of Life as assessed by PDQ-39, SF-36 and EQ-5D at 12 months post surgery12 months post surgery
Percent time spent in ON and OFF at 12 months post surgery12 months post surgery
Activities of Daily Living subscore of the UPDRS at 12 months post surgery12 months post surgery
